Could it be solved by just rebuild Shairport Sync with output_format = "S24";
I guess I am not that lucky but better ask
Since the Airplay softvolume sits in the Airplay renderer, and if understood the below correct (which may not be the case
) Shairport Sync can be built to output 24bit audio, it could solve the problem depending on what data types where used when doing the volume multiplication before writing to the 24bit output ?
// These are parameters for the "alsa" audio back end.
// For this section to be operative, Shairport Sync must be built with the following configuration flag:
// --with-alsa
alsa =
{
// output_device = "default"; // the name of the alsa output device. Use "alsamixer" or "aplay" to find out the names of devices, mixers, etc.
// mixer_control_name = "PCM"; // the name of the mixer to use to adjust output volume. If not specified, volume in adjusted in software.
// mixer_device = "default"; // the mixer_device default is whatever the output_device is. Normally you wouldn't have to use this.
// can be 44100, 88200, 176400 or 352800, but the device must have the capability.
output_rate = 44100;
// can be "U8", "S8", "S16", "S24", "S24_3LE", "S24_3BE" or "S32", but the device must have the capability. Except where stated using (*LE or *BE), endianness matches that of the processor.
output_format = "S16";
